BigQuery
- On-demand billing charges for bytes read from every column a query references, so an unqualified select or a missing partition filter turns a routine query into a large bill, and the cost is discovered after the fact rather than at review time.
- There is no way to join tables that live in different regions, so a data estate split across regions for residency reasons has to be reconciled with copies and the storage and transfer that implies.
- It is not built for point lookups; retrieving a single row has latency measured in hundreds of milliseconds or more, so BigQuery cannot serve an application's read path and always needs a second store in front of it.
- Frequent small mutations run into DML concurrency limits and the cost of rewriting storage blocks, so a workload that updates individual rows continuously behaves badly compared with an append-only design.
- The compute exists only inside Google Cloud, so while tables can be exported, the accumulated GoogleSQL, scheduled queries, authorised views, ML models and IAM structure do not move, and switching warehouses is a rewrite of the analytical layer.

Apache Superset: What does Apache Superset cost?
Apache Superset is open-source software available free under the Apache 2.0 license. There are no licensing costs, subscription fees, or per-seat charges for using Superset itself.
SourceBigQuery: How is BigQuery actually billed?
Storage is billed separately from compute. Compute is either on-demand, priced by the bytes a query reads from the referenced columns, or capacity-based, where you reserve autoscaling slots. Most cost surprises come from on-demand queries that scan more than expected.
Apache Superset: Is there a paid version of Apache Superset?
Apache Superset itself is free and open-source. Preset.io offers commercial Superset hosting with premium support, but this is a separate vendor service, not an official paid tier of Superset.
SourceBigQuery: How do I control query cost?
Partition and cluster tables so queries prune data, select only the columns needed, use materialised views for repeated aggregations, and set maximum bytes billed on queries so a runaway scan fails instead of billing.
BigQuery: Can I use it without being on Google Cloud?
The service only runs on Google Cloud. BigQuery Omni can query data held in S3 or Azure storage, but the compute is still Google's and the account relationship is still with Google.
BigQuery: Is it suitable for serving application queries?
No. Latency for single-row reads is far too high. BigQuery is an analytical warehouse and application read paths need a transactional database or a cache in front of it.
BigQuery: When should I move from on-demand to capacity pricing?
When on-demand spend becomes both large and predictable, or when unpredictable spend is a bigger problem than query queueing. The switch trades a variable bill for a fixed one plus contention between workloads.
